The story of Richard Charles began in 1840 in Haverfordwest, Pembrokeshire, Wales. In 1871, Richard Charles resided in Coity, Glamorgan, Wales. Richard Charles married Ann Lawrence, and had children including Elizabeth Jane Charles, James Rowland Charles, Lettice Charles, Mary Ann Charles, Minnie Charles, Sarah Charles, Thomas George Charles. Richard Charles passed away in 1903 in Neath, Glamorganshire, Wales.
